### **Cultural Context: Japan’s Relationship with Earthquakes**
Japan has a long history of dealing with earthquakes, and its culture reflects that. From the ancient Shinto belief that earthquakes are caused by the god of the earth, Namazu, to modern-day disaster preparedness, Japan has always been both fascinated and terrified by seismic activity.
The country’s infrastructure is built to withstand earthquakes, and its people are some of the most prepared in the world. But even with all that preparation, the unpredictability of nature keeps everyone on edge. The Japan earthquake today is a reminder of that.
